Spring Fun Run to Pabineau Falls with Club 15 Alnwick

We joined the Spring Fun Ride to Pabineau Falls!

A large number of Region 2 members came out on Saturday to support Club VTT/ATV Alnwick (Club 15, Region 4) with their Spring Fun Run heading to Pabineau Falls, a beautiful attraction just south of Bathurst, NB. within the boundary of Club 5 VTT / ATV Chaleur in Region 2.

The run started at the Alnwick club parking lot (across from the La Bonne Route restaurant) with approximately 50 ATVs and Side by Sides lined up and ready for a great day.  The weather cooperated for the most part, with only a slight occassional drizzle and high temperatures of 12C (not bad for a May run in northeastern New Brunswick).

The group took a couple of extended rest stops on the way to Pabineau Falls and arrived after approximately 4 hours on the trails.  While at the falls, members took the time to hike around and enjoy the scenic beauty as well as break out the barbeques for some great food.  Lots of new friends were made on this trip.

Club 3: Trail Status Run to Kedgwick

A small group from the club did a run on Saturday to investigate the status of Trail #10 from Christoper area (near Glencoe) to Kedgwick.

These are our findings:
1- Staging area near Chirstopher.  Trails looked good with little snow.
2 – Made a quick stop at the site of a future rest area planned by Club 3
3 – Found snow early and lots of it throughout the trail.
4 – Upsilquitch Bridge looks good but river is very high
5 – There are 18 bridges to Kedgwick and several have railing damage.
6 – Ice is deep in some places and washouts are VERY dangerous.
7 – Passed by Grog Brook Falls.  Water is high but falls was beautiful.
8 – Needed to clear several fallen trees so always good to have a saw.
9 – Time for lunch and then back home.

Total distance travelled was approximately 150 kms return and we took 10 hours to complete.

Club 2: Ride des Sucreries

The 2025 Ride des Sucreries - A sweet Success Dispite the Weather!

Once again this year, the community rallied in force to participate in our unmissable Ride des Sucreries! Despite the unpredictable weather, no fewer than 310 registrations were recorded, once again demonstrating the enthusiasm and loyalty of the participants.

Thanks to the hard work of the organizing committee and the support of our partners, more than 50 participation and attendance prizes were awarded, adding a festive touch to this already special day.
